|
Проскакивает автоматическая нумерация документов |
☑ |
0
Gsoom2010
01.08.12
✎
10:28
|
Доброе утро.
Проблема: Пропускаются номера при нумерации документов. Создаю документ 200100, закрываю его не сохраняя, создаю снова документ, ожидаю увидеть 200100 но вижу 200101. Выходят проскоки в нумерации, потому что если в новом документе 200101 я вручную верну номер 200100 то следующей новый документ будет уже 200102, снова проскок.
Формирование номера у меня идёт с префиксом из модуля объекта:
Функция ПолучитьПрефиксНомера()
Возврат Константы.ПрефиксНумерации.Получить();
КонецФункции
Процедура ПриУстановкеНовогоНомера(СтандартнаяОбработка, Префикс)
Префикс = ПолучитьПрефиксНомера();
КонецПроцедуры
Я так понимаю что номер резервируется системой автонумерации, но не освобождается при закрытии документа. Как сделать чтобы освобождался сразу после закрытия?
|
|
1
Andrewww
01.08.12
✎
10:33
|
Свойства конфигурации(верхнего уровня метаданных) - свойство "Освобождать автоматически".
|
|
2
Andrewww
01.08.12
✎
10:33
|
Аа... как обычно :) Свойство "Режим автонумерации объектов"
|
|
3
Gsoom2010
01.08.12
✎
10:37
|
Вот блин...
|
|
4
Gsoom2010
01.08.12
✎
10:38
|
Большое спасибо, помню что где-то видел, всё искал в свойствах объекта...
|
|
5
Andrewww
01.08.12
✎
10:39
|
Пожалуйста, тоже не сразу вспомнил где встречал :)
|
|
6
Лефмихалыч
01.08.12
✎
10:44
|
(0) у формы документа отключи автонумерацию
|
|